A Fully Self-Powered Wearable Leg Movement Sensing System for Human Health Monitoring.


ABSTRACT: Energy-autonomous wearable human activity monitoring is imperative for daily healthcare, benefiting from long-term sustainable uses. Herein, a fully self-powered wearable system, enabling real-time monitoring and assessments of human multimodal health parameters including knee joint movement, metabolic energy, locomotion speed, and skin temperature, which are fully self-powered by highly-efficient flexible thermoelectric generators (f-TEGs) is proposed and developed. The wearable system is composed of f-TEGs, fabric strain sensors, ultra-low-power edge computing, and Bluetooth. The f-TEGs worn on the leg not only harvest energy from body heat and supply power sustainably for the whole monitoring system, but also serve as zero-power motion sensors to detect limb movement and skin temperature. The fabric strain sensor made by printing PEDOT: PSS on pre-stretched nylon fiber-wrapped rubber band enables high-fidelity and ultralow-power measurements on highly-dynamic knee movements. Edge computing is elaborately designed to estimate multimodal health parameters including time-varying metabolic energy in real-time, which are wirelessly transmitted via Bluetooth. The whole monitoring system is operated automatically and intelligently, works sustainably in both static and dynamic states, and is fully self-powered by the f-TEGs.
